...the most advanced optimizing tool for STePS systems.
All Bluetooth capable displays SC-EM800, SC-E8000, SC-E7000, SC-E6100, SW-EN600-L switch and EW-EN100 cockpit are supported!
Additionally to DU-E80X0 motors, now DU-EP801, DU-EP800, DU-EP600, DU-E7000, DU-E6XXX and DU-E50X0 drive units are supported too.
Partially compatible also with the latest Shimano motor firmware versions!

This version 1.87 for STePS drive units is capable to communicate with the SC-EM800, SC-E8000, SC-E7000, SC-E6100 display types, EW-EN100 cockpit as well as the SW-EN600-L unit.
This version is capable to optimize DU-EP801, DU-E800, DU-EP600, DU-E80X0, DU-E7000, DU-E6XXX and DU-E50X0 drive units as well as its variants "RS" and "CRG".
